#e820e9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e820e9 is composed of 91% red, 12.5%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.4% cyan, 86.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 299.7 degrees, a saturation of 82% and a lightness of 52%. #e820e9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ff40ff with #d100d3. Closest websafe color is: #ff33ff.

Shades and Tints of #e820e9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090109 is the darkest color, while #fef6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e820e9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b7e8b is the less saturated color, while #fb0dfc is the most saturated one.
